I got this the next day after the Hadley resource roundup about Alzheimer's 
They talked about when what is happening is an indication of the onset of Alzheimer’s, and when it is just part of aging.
The key is if it is a change in behavior.
If a person that has had good memory starts to forget how to get somewhere, it may be an indication of the beginning of Alzheimer’s, but if it is a person that has always had to make notes to remember things, it is likely just a result of aging.
